The mandate of this division is to promote an environment of industrial peace and harmony by ensuring uninterrupted production of goods and services.

Employment Standards



WHAT WE DO


The mandate of the Employment Standards Branch is to administer the Employment Standards Act. The act establishes employee entitlements with respect to payment of wages, vacation pay, statutory holidays, notice of termination, minimum wage rates, overtime pay, maternity and parental leave protection.

The Branch, in carrying out its mandate, provides factual information to the public through telephone contact, office interviews, information sessions, routine inspections and distribution of Departmental literature.

Worker Adviser Program



WHAT WE DO


The program assists injured workers or their families on the benefits they are entitled to receive under the Workers Compensation Act on Prince Edward Island.

Labour Relations Board



WHAT WE DO


The Labour Relations Board provides a quasi-judicial process to resolve applications that either management or labour may bring before it. The board attempts to provide a speedy resolution for all matters while at the same time trying to provide for and maintain harmonious labour relations in the province.

Industrial Relations Council



WHAT WE DO


Under the Labour Act, the role of the Industrial Relations Council is that of a labour/management advisory body with a broad mandate, aimed at fostering good employer/employee relations in the province.

Industrial Relations



WHAT WE DO


The Branch is responsible for providing a variety of services to the unionized workforce of Prince Edward Island. In meeting this objective the Branch:
  • responds to applications for conciliation and mediation services upon request from labour and/or management when there is an impasse in negotiation;
  • All applications for conciliation must be accompanied by a Request for Appointment of a Conciliation Officer;
  • averts work stoppages through third party assistance;
  • works with the parties in resolving work stoppages;
  • assists in the development of sound labour/management relations;
  • assists organizations in establishing a labour/management committee in the workplace.

Employment Standards Board



WHAT WE DO


The primary role of the Employment Standards Board is to hear appeal presentations from employers who have a complaint filed against them for alleged violations of the Employment Standards Act and also to make recommendations to the Lieutenant Governor in Council with regard to changes in the Minimum Wage Order.
